PackageDescriptionruntime files for the OpenEXR image library OpenEXR is a high dynamic-range (HDR) image file format developed by Industrial Light & Magic for use in computer imaging applications. . OpenEXR's features include: * Higher dynamic range and colour precision than existing 8- and 10-bit image file formats. * Support for the "half" 16-bit floating-point pixel format. * Multiple lossless image compression algorithms. Some of the included codecs can achieve 2:1 lossless compression ratios on images with film grain. * Extensibility. New compression codecs and image types can easily be added by extending the C++ classes included in the OpenEXR software distribution. New image attributes (strings, vectors, integers, etc.) can be added to OpenEXR image headers without affecting backward compatibility with existing OpenEXR applications. . This package contains the following shared library: * IlmImf - a library that reads and writes OpenEXR images.
